Transaction 63df46121f71a3cf93fe9424afceb6bcd5c0fedd64775fbeb3d5b08199bfd04d

1 Input
2 Outputs
  • 63df46121f71a3cf93fe9424afceb6bcd5c0fedd64775fbeb3d5b08199bfd04d:0
  • value  971889146
    address  3FKBEzYfNJ1kqph1ud8zm774nHT2NqDN6t
  • 63df46121f71a3cf93fe9424afceb6bcd5c0fedd64775fbeb3d5b08199bfd04d:1
  • value  23096862682
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w